Tenaya Creek Tenaya Creek flows through what used to be Mirror Lake. The park naturalists thought it was unnatural to continually dredge the lake so they have let it fill up with sand and dirt to create Mirror Meadow a bit farther upstream. There are still some spots that create "mirrors" and provide nice reflections of Half Dome and Mt. Watkins..
Merced River Reflections There are a number of contrasting elements in this image that make it work for me. The smooth water contrasts with the rapids, the green water with both the white water and the gray rocks, and the vertical lines in the reflection contrast with the curve of the tree branch in the foreground.
